I regret leaving MetroPCS for Sprint. Since day one of signing up, I've had constant issues with sprint. I have an iPhone 4S that's supposed to be getting 3G speeds but it's basically a pretty brick on Sprint's network. If I leave my home or leave a wifi connection, my phone is useless. Their 3G network is too slow to be of any use. I run speed tests everywhere I go and they usually return 0s for download and upload speeds or errors for a lost connection. Never mind trying to use my GPS apps because it will lose connection before you can even route directions. If my phone leaves a Sprint 3G area (which happens more often than I wish) I can no longer send or receive text messages. It's really frustrating to see that I can't even use the most basic of services when I need them. Data service is secondary for a phone in my opinion but you don't get the service you pay for. They like to flaunt their "unlimited" data usage but what good is unlimited data if you can't even use the data? I really regret signing up with sprint. I've called to report these issues and they keep telling me the same thing, "network upgrades are coming soon"... it's been two years and honestly, their service is only getting worst by the day. In the past year, I have traveled throughout Florida (Tallahassee, Orlando, south Florida) and no matter where I've been, the service is still crap. It is hopeless and disappointing to say Sprint is my carrier. And bringing my phone out in public is almost embarrassing since it just won't work.
